Two sonnets of Michael Madhusudan Dutt's 'Chaturdashpadi Kavitabali (18)' written about Ishwar Chandra. Although the first one (‘On the occasion of a respected friend in Bengal’) had a bit of a cover, but in the second one (‘Ishwar Chandra Vidyasagar’) it has become evident in the title.

When Vidyasagar's father told him to take a bath, he would not go near the pond for two or three days. Again, on the day when he was forbidden to take a bath, he would not get up from the pond for two or three hours.

Ishwar Chandra was terrified of the test. He would run away from home whenever he heard about the test.

A widow's wedding was to be held in the village of Vidyasagar in 189. But the marriage did not take place for any special reason. For this he left the village. And did not return to his village until the day before he died.

Ishwar Chandra Vidyasagar married his son to a widow, against the wishes of everyone in the family. But later he abandoned that boy.
